An ethical investment ISA is a tax-efficient way to invest in companies that have a positive impact on the world By selecting companies that are socially responsible and environmentally friendly, investors can feel good about where their money is going This type of investment is also known as sustainable, socially responsible, or impact investing.

The recent rise in popularity of ethical investment ISAs is due in part to an increasing awareness of social and environmental issues As businesses face increasing scrutiny over their practices, consumers are demanding more transparency and accountability This has led to a growing number of investors seeking out companies that not only provide a financial return but also contribute to positive change in the world.

One of the key benefits of investing in an ethical ISA is the ability to diversify your portfolio while still adhering to your values By selecting companies that are committed to sustainability, human rights, and social justice, investors can build a portfolio that reflects their ethical beliefs This can provide peace of mind knowing that their investments are not contributing to practices that harm people or the planet.

Furthermore, ethical investment ISAs have been shown to perform just as well, if not better, than traditional investment options Studies have found that companies with strong environmental, social, and governance (ESG) practices tend to be more resilient in the face of economic downturns and are better equipped to navigate risks like climate change and social unrest By investing in these companies, investors can potentially achieve both financial returns and positive impact.

Shareholders have the opportunity to vote on corporate resolutions and engage in dialogue with company management to advocate for change This can include pushing for increased diversity on corporate boards, reducing carbon emissions, and improving supply chain transparency By using their shareholder votes to influence company policies, investors can help drive positive change from the inside.

In addition to the social and environmental benefits, ethical investment ISAs also offer tax advantages Investments held within an ISA are sheltered from income tax, capital gains tax, and dividend tax This can result in significant savings over the long term, allowing investors to keep more of their returns and reinvest them for future growth.

When considering an ethical investment ISA, it’s important to do your research and understand the criteria used to screen companies Each provider may have different standards for what qualifies as ethical, so it’s essential to find one that aligns with your values Look for providers that are transparent about their investment process and have a track record of positive impact.
